Mausam earns Rs 9 crore on opening day

Veteran actor Pankaj Kapur's directorial debut Mausam starring his son Shahid Kapoor and actress Sonam Kapoor had a good opening on Friday as it earned approximately Rs 9 crore on the first day, an informed source said.

Made at a budget of Rs 35 crore, the film released in around 1,900 screens and is going strong with 100 per cent occupancy. The film, as per the makers, attempts to bring back the true romance of the bygone era.

Mausam is a love story which shows how a couple is forced into alienation because of the socio-political situations around them.

It captures the crest and trough they go through a span of 10 years until they reunite and make a happy ending.

Shahid Kapoor plays the role of an air force pilot while Sonam Kapoor plays a Kashmiri girl.

The film was supposed to release on September 16 but it was postponed after the delay in getting a No Objection Certificate (NOC) from the Indian Air Force which had objections over a few scenes.
